Our client is one of the UKs leading vehicle hire and fleet management businesses, and they are currently looking for skilled Vehicle Technicians to join their growing team across multiple sites nationwide.
This role will focus primarily on the maintenance, servicing, and repair of light commercial vehicles (LCVs) and vans, ensuring fleet reliability and safety for a wide customer base.
This is a fantastic opportunity for a qualified technician looking for job stability, structured working hours, and long-term career progression within a well-established organisation.
- Carry out servicing, maintenance, and repairs on a range of vans and light commercial vehicles
- Complete MOT preparation and general inspections
- Work efficiently to meet productivity and workshop targets
Requirements:
- Level 3 NVQ / City & Guilds in Vehicle Maintenance & Repair (preferred)
- Proven experience as a Vehicle Technician / Mechanic / LCV Technician
- Experience working on vans or commercial vehicles (highly desirable)
- Full UK Driving Licence
